Transaction

10f010637ce5d6bd482f185685992a814c8f0c6437909030bd00348a54332fbd

Summary

In Block389020
TimeSun, 08 Oct 2023 06:11:15 UTC
Total Input2306.1819832 Nebula
Total Output2340.1819832 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
577116 Confirmations2340.1819832 Nebula
Raw Transaction